DALLAS, Texas - The Newman men's tennis team earned a berth into the Heartland Conference Championship match with a 5-4 win over St. Mary's in the first round of the Heartand Conference Men's Tennis Championships, which began Thursday in Dallas, Texas.
Thursday's semi-final match was about as tightly-contested as a match could be. Wins on the No. 1 and No. 3 doubles courts gave the Jets an early advantage. Newman's
Jimmy Dunseith and
Chris King held off the St. Mary's tandem of Guy Rutten and Marcin Marczewski for an 8-6 win on the No. 1 court, while
Nathan Peters and
Victor Bello picked up an 8-6 win over the Rattler duo of Nicolas Moreno and Nestor Moreno in the No. 3 court. The Jets' only loss in doubles play came on the No. 2 court, where
Kevin Klein and Igor Ozegovic dropped an 8-6 decision to Andrea Klipa and Jake Williams.
Newman sealed the deal in singles play. Dunseith needed three sets, but held off Marczewski for a 5-7, 7-5, 6-3 win on the No. 1 court to push Newman's advantage to 3-1. King followed with 6-2, 6-1 straight-set win in the No. 3 match, while Ozegovic's 6-2, 6-4 win on the No. 4 court gave the Jets their decisive fifth win.
The win allows Newman to advance to the Heartland Conference Championship match, which is scheduled to be played Friday at 10 a.m., weather permitting. The Jets will face St. Edward's, a 5-0 winner over Dallas Baptist, for a shot at the team's first Heartland Conference title.
